Bimal Gurung, Binay Tamang, Ajay Edwards - fresh political equations in Darjeeling Hills?
IANS -
On the other hand, Edwards and his newly-formed Hamro Party shocked all by capturing the Darjeeling Municipality in the polls in February this year. However, within ten months from then, his party is all set to lose control over the board, as six Hamro Party councillors have shifted camp to the opposition alliance of Anit Thapa-led Bharatiya Gorkha Prajatantrik Morcha (BGPM) and the Trinamool.

After Manish Sisodia accuses L-G of seeking files 'directly', Chief Secy asks to provide details
IANS -
Sisodia had written to the L-G, alleging that the L-G secretariat has "in recent past resorted to the practice of calling for files from various departments through their respective secretaries, the Chief Secretary and transacting business thereon, such as approving the issuance of notifications etc., completely bypassing the concerned minister as also the Cabinet".
